      Trevali drills 1,258 g/t Ag over one m at Santander


      2008-05-01 09:44 ET - News Release

      Dr. Mark Cruise reports

      TREVALI INTERSECTS HIGH GRADE SILVER MINERALIZATION AT SANTANDER PROJECT, PERU

      Trevali Resources Corp.'s latest drill assay results from its Santander project have returned the highest grade silver mineralization encountered on the property to date. Hole SAN-018 intersected a one-metre interval grading 40.4 ounces (1,258 grams) silver per tonne.

      Elevated silver mineralization appears to be associated with a late-stage oblique veining overprint roughly perpendicular to the principal mantos -- suggesting that the current drill program may be underestimating their distribution. This model will be tested by future drill programs. The Santander Zn-Pb-Ag property is located in the province of Huaral, west-central Peru.

      Magistral Norte drilling

      Highlights of the latest assay results include:

      Drill hole SAN-016 intersecting 13.65 metres of 10.37 per cent Zn, 5.45 per cent Pb, 5.7 ounces (178.5 grams per tonne) Ag and 0.25 per cent Cu from 133.65 to 147.3 metres downhole -- within which six metres returned 17.14 per cent Zn, 8.17 per cent Pb, 8.3 ounces (257 g/t) Ag and 0.4 per cent Cu;

      Drill hole SAN-018 intersected multiple horizons -- an upper zone of seven metres from 140.95 to 147.95 metres that returned 4.65 per cent Zn, 4.39 per cent Pb, 2.1 ounces (66.8 g/t) Ag and 0.1 per cent Cu and a lower zone of 6.3 metres at 7.85 per cent Zn, 6.66 per cent Pb, 8.9 ounces (277.3 g/t) Ag and 0.1 per cent Cu from 152.9 to 159.2 metres downhole -- within which a one-metre interval assayed 11.42 per cent Zn, 8.16 per cent Pb, 40.4 ounces (1,258 g/t) Ag and 0.24 per cent Cu.

      The company recently completed its initial phase of resource drilling on the Magistral Norte zone -- the first of four high-priority outcropping mineralized zones termed Magistral Norte, Central, Sur and Puajanca respectively. Forty drill holes for a total of 7,009 metres have tested the zone to a vertical depth of approximately 180 to 200 metres. Mineralization remains partially open to the north and specifically to depth where multiple replacement zones have been intersected.

      Property-scale structural reconstructions and comparisons with the old Santander mine, located 1.5 kilometres to the southeast, indicate the Magistral Norte zone has additional depth potential conservatively ranging from 300 to 500 metres vertical extent. Consequently the company is highly confident that it can easily grow the Magistral Norte resource with additional future resource drilling.

      Three drill rigs are currently testing Magistral Sur -- following which testing of Magistral Central and several additional high-priority geophysical exploration targets will commence.

      A total of 63 diamond drill holes have been completed to date, 40 drill holes at the Magistral Norte zone, 19 holes drilled on 40-metre centres at Magistral Sur and four holes -- of which two are in progress -- at Magistral Central.

      Magistral Sur drilling

      Magistral Sur is located approximately 700 metres south-southeast of Magistral Norte. Due to logistical requirements drill holes SAN-009, 013, 014 and 015 were collared at the southernmost extent of the outcropping Magistral Sur zone. The modest results indicate mineralization increases to the north. The most current drill hole, SAN-050, confirms this theory -- drilling is in progress however thus far the hole has intersected disseminated and semi-massive to massive sulphide mineralization over a 47-metre interval. Subsequent assay results will ultimately determine how much of the interval returns economic grades.

      Geological interpretation indicates that the Magistral Sur body formed at higher temperatures to Magistral Norte. It is more massive in nature and contains a higher temperature gangue mineral assembly indicating a proximal location to the metaliferous fluid source. Detailed logging indicates it forms a subvertical pipe-shaped body steeply dipping to the west and consequently is anticipated to have good to excellent depth potential.

      Project background

      The Santander property is located approximately 215 kilometres by road from Lima. The current diamond drill program represents the first modern exploration on the large, 4,455-hectare (44-square-kilometre) mine and exploration lease.

      Site infrastructure includes a large camp and associated support facilities, an ore processing/concentrator plant (including various crushers, mills and cell houses) able to produce zinc, lead-silver and copper concentrates, and the company's leased Tingo hydroelectric power station, located approximately 17 km down-valley to the west.

      Future work

      The company is committed to fast-tracking this highly prospective, eminently accessible and exciting project to production in the shortest time frame feasible. The company is currently examining the feasibility of commencing production from the potentially large tailings resource followed by high-grade hard-rock production upon receipt of all necessary permits.

      The present resource definition program is designed to define mineralization to nominal open-pittable depths, although considerable geotechnical and geological analysis, and modelling are required prior to assigning the optimum mining method.

      Golder Associates of Vancouver has been retained to complete an NI 43-101-compliant resource estimate and initial mine scoping study.

      Qualified person and quality control/quality assurance

      Dr. Mark D. Cruise, EurGeol, Trevali's president and chief executive officer, and a qualified person as defined by National Instrument 43-101, has supervised the preparation of the scientific and technical information that forms the basis for this news release. Dr. Cruise is not independent of the company, as he is an officer and shareholder.

      The work programs at Trevali were designed by, and are supervised by, Dr. Cruise and Les Oldham, general manager, Consultora Minera Anglo Peruana S.A. (independent geological consultants), who together are responsible for all aspects of the work, including the quality control/quality assurance program. On-site personnel at the project rigorously collect and track samples which are then security sealed and shipped to ACME Laboratories, Vancouver, for assay. ACME's quality system complies with the requirements for the International Standards ISO 9001:2000 and ISO 17025:1999. Analytical accuracy and precision are monitored by the analysis of reagent blanks, reference material and replicate samples. Quality control is further assured by the use of international and in-house standards. Blind certified reference material is inserted at regular intervals into the sample sequence by Trevali personnel in order to independently assess analytical accuracy. Finally, representative blind duplicate samples are routinely forwarded to ACME and an ISO-compliant third party laboratory for additional quality control.
